Rep. Albert Camp

Former Representative for Georgia’s 4th District


Camp was the representative for Georgia’s 4th congressional district and was a Democrat. He served from 1939 to 1954.

Missed Votes

From Oct 1939 to Jul 1954, Camp missed 62 of 1,420 roll call votes, which is 4.4%. This is worse than the median of 2.7% among the lifetime records of representatives serving in Jul 1954. The chart below reports missed votes over time.

We don’t track why legislators miss votes, but it’s often due to medical absenses, major life events, and running for higher office.
